CoStar Real Estate Manager is looking for a Senior Data Operations Analyst to join a highly motivated team that is responsible for the daily operations of CoStar’s data environments. The ideal candidate enjoys tackling complex problems and excels at collaborating with customers and internal teams. Will be responsible for solving challenging and time-sensitive production issues focused on CoStar/Customer integrations. Must understand database environments, ETL and triage tools. Enjoys solving problems and making our customer successful.

This position is located in our Atlanta, GA office and offers a hybrid schedule of 3 days onsite, 2 days remote.

Responsibilities

  • Serves as liaison for customers for professional service and support requests

  • Troubleshoot simple and complex integration errors / issues with assistance

  • Analyze and maintain integration processes, procedures and requirements

  • Developed understanding with database technology with proficiency in dealing with data formats including Microsoft Excel, Access, SQL and other formats

  • Coordinate with Client Services Team members to ensure adherence to SLA requirements

  • Support all work management and quality control processes

  • Demonstrate proficiency in requirements gathering, gaining customer approval, execution, testing and delivery of professional services requests for CoStar Real Estate Manager Customers’ integrations with assistance from lead or Manager.

  • Work in coordination with Business Relationship Managers to expand customer adoption

  • Assist in Providing support for high priority issues through either a late shift or an on call services.

Basic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in computer science or a related field from an accredited, not for profit university or college.

  • 5+ years of experience with SQL Server; writing advanced SELECT and UPDATE statements. Capable of reading SQL Procedures / SQL Server Jobs and get the general idea of function.

  • Proficient in requirements gathering, gaining customer approval, execution, testing and delivery of professional services requests for CoStar Real Estate Manager Customers with minor assistance when needed.

  • Analytical, technical, and problem-solving skills

  • Must possess strong oral and written communication skills.

  • Proficiency in handling database technology including MS SQL Server, ETL Tools (SSIS or equivalent), Informatica, Mulesoft, AppConnect, Microsoft Excel, Access, SQL and other formats

  • Ability to define problems, collect data, establish facts, and draw valid conclusions to benefit the organization and maintain client satisfaction. Also, must have the ability to see consequences of choices for solutions provided.

  • Work well in a team environment, as well as independently

  • Work with little supervision and manage time and priorities in a demanding environment

  • Possess technical understanding of Web-based application environments, be proficient in Microsoft Office Professional

  • Proficient with customer management tools, Salesforce / TFS

  • A track record of commitment to prior employers.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Proficient in using Costar software

  • Proven ability to train and mentor others in this position

  • Experience with commercial real estate – knowledge of real estate industry specific business processes
